Sure, Andrew Haley from Red Hat announced [1] two years ago that OpenJDK 6 would still be supported, and we can expect the same support for OpenJDK 7 in the future. Also the installation stats [2] for Debian show that OpenJDK 6 is still strong, about twice OpenJDK 7. And on Ubuntu [3] it's a 10x factor. So two years after the official EOL of Java 6 it's far from dead on the server side.
